Adjusting
the
Delay
Time
of
the
Rear
Speakers
To
turn
off
the
surround
effect
Press
SOUND
HELD
ON/OFF
to
OFF.
The
sound
without
surround
effect
will
resume.
The
settings
of
the
center
and
rear
level
and
the
delay
time
are
not
cleared
until
you
change
the
settings.
They
will
be
recalled
whenever
you
select
a
sound
field
program.
Note
The
delay
time
for
the
rear
speakers
can
be
adjusted
even
in
the
3
CH
LOGIC
mode.
for
DOLBY
SUR
(Dolby
surround)
mode
The
delay
time
is
a
time
between
the
surround
sound
from
the
front
and
that
from
rear
speakers.
The
delay
time
is
adjustable
from
15
ms
to
30
ms.
For
the
adjustable
range
of
the
delay
time
except
for
the
DOLBY
SUR
mode,
see
page
23.
